Also, there is a way to fix it by changing the O-Rings which one of my customers did. WebDec 30, 2024 · Hair dryer. A nice idea to try if you have a little to moderate moisture lingering in your headlight is to use the hand hairdryer. A hairdryer produces enough heat to dry up some of the water in the headlight and quicken the evaporation process that will help remove the remaining water. You’ll need to allow the heat from the hair dryer to ...

I also show you how to locate where the water is getting in, and how to permanently fix ... signalink usb windows 11 setupthe process is longWebOct 20, 2024 · 2) Replace the Headlight Gasket. On some vehicles, there is a way to disassemble the headlight housing to replace the headlight gasket. If your car is more than 10 years old, this may a good course of action. This is especially true if your vehicle sat out in the sun for many years.
